I have never used a sponge filter and I have a 10 gallon tank I want to set up as a fry tank. Can I attach a sponge filter to the side of my planted 55 gal tank to seed it and then use it in the 10 gal when needed and then place it back in the 55 gal to keep the bacteria alive when the 10 gal is not in use?
Will there be any negative effects to the 55 by adding and removing the extra sponge filter? This seems like an easier way than trying to keep an empty tank 'alive'.

That will work fine but keepin mind that the sponge will only have so much ability and won't tank a huge bio-load...mind you, you can't put much in a 10
